Hello,
I've created an Event Handler/Listener like so:
import flash.events.Event;
public class DanielEvent extends Event {
public var data:*;
public static const APP_STARTED:String = "APP_STARTED";
public function DanielEvent(n:String, data:*){
this.data = data;
super(n)
}
}
Listening to an event using:
addEventListener(DanielEvent.APP_STARTED, appStarted);
Dispatching an event by:
dispatchEvent(new DanielEvent("APP_STARTED", "test"))
And receiving the data by:
private function appStarted(e:Event){
trace(e.data)
}
But I get the error:
Access of possibly undefined property data through a reference with static type flash.events:Event.